Job Description

Roles & Responsibilities

The Merchandise Admin Executive will support the team in activities related to import, export, legislative approval systemization of stock, maintenance supplier compliance and Electronic Data Interchange (EDI). This will be a key role to support the team drive the performance against sales and margin targets, maximizing in-season opportunities and affecting future inventory.

What You’ll Be Doing.

  • Ensuring all necessary records, files and databases are maintained accurately and updated in a timely manner accordance with supplier records and feeds.
  • Validation of order creation against vendor catalogue and resolution of discrepancies.
  • Manage all aspects relating to the shipments and logistical processing.
  • Coordinate shipments with EDI suppliers and Al Tayer logistics to ensure timely deliveries.
  • Obtain the information of upcoming shipments and coordinate proper system checks.
  • Report supplier compliance related to discrepancies on the physical receipt against invoice and damage stock in the shipment and obtain credit note from supplier.
  • Keep record of warehouse documentation for contracts, order, invoice, fulfilment, and deliveries
  • Handling of Short & Excess units, follow up on credit notes.
